Azenta, Inc. earns a C (Mixed — selective) forensic quality grade, and its Altman Z-score is 9.1, placing it in the Safe zone. 5 forensic signals were flagged in its latest SEC filings, led by return on invested capital.
What the filings flag
-1%Return on invested capital.Return on invested capital is -1% and steady — well below its ~9% cost of capital, so reinvested dollars may be destroying value, not building it.
4% of revStock-based comp load.Stock-based compensation ran 4% of revenue and 54% of free cash flow in FY2025 — about $0.45 per diluted share. Heavy — a large slice of 'free cash flow' is really being paid out in stock, so the true owner cash per share is well below the headline.
stoppedShareholder returns — halted.Capital returns have STOPPED — $662M of buybacks + dividends in FY2024, but ~$0 in FY2025. A halt usually means the company is conserving cash; understand why before reading it as neutral.
suspendedDividend — suspended.The dividend has been SUSPENDED — $7M paid in FY2022, then $0 in FY2024. A suspension is a major signal the board is conserving cash; the prior payment history doesn't offset it.
$111MGoodwill impairments.Took $111M of goodwill writedowns across 1 year(s) (FY2024 ($111M)). Writedowns mean past acquisitions underperformed what was paid for them — worth weighing on capital-allocation skill.
